I choose to live alone. The nuptial bands seem all a. rage With one continual tone. About the bachelors and old raaids, i$ecaue they live alone. Let others seek their happiness And 1 will seek my own; And let them marry if they please, 1 choose to lire alone. Where two are formed for social life, Ana gentle passions own; -Tis bet they should he man and wife; And 1 should live alone. Where two with tranquil peace are blest, And strife have never known, fo doubt they think it is not best That one should live alone. Increased m family and cares They must look to their own, Perhaps perplexed with these affairs, 1 have my peace alone. While some to poverty and strife, There wretched fate bemoan, And wear away a tedious ife, 1 hare my peace alone. Ensnared, and cannot disengage, The truth they will not owu, But envy me my happiness Because Hive alone. The force of love I don't deny Its senile power I own, Jjut prize n:y liberty so high, I choose to live alone,
